Solution Overview
Problem
Conventional online recruiting systems are inefficient in matching job seekers' resumes with suitable job postings, requiring time-consuming manual review and evaluation, as they lack the ability to effectively compare and rank non-standardized data sets.
Innovation Solution
A system and method that processes non-standardized data sets by parsing them into standardized profiles, identifying attributes, and ranking them based on metrics such as band position, occurrences, and support values, allowing for efficient comparison and matching of resumes and job postings.
Engineering Contradictions & Design Principles
Engineering Contradiction Analysis
1Measurement precision
If manual review and evaluation of resumes and job postings is used, then matching accuracy can be maintained, but time consumption and operational effort increase significantly
Solution Approach 1:
The patent creates standardized profile copies of resumes and job postings that capture essential attributes in a uniform format. These standardized profiles serve as simplified representations that enable automated comparison while preserving the key information needed for accurate matching, thus reducing manual review time without sacrificing matching quality
Solution Approach 2:
The system transforms unstructured resume and job posting data into structured profiles with standardized parameters and attributes. By changing the data representation from free-text formats to parameterized structures with defined metrics, the system enables automated algorithms to efficiently compare and rank matches while maintaining accuracy
2Quantity of substance
If keyword searches are used to reduce the number of resumes or job postings, then the total volume decreases, but the ability to find the most suitable match requires individual review of each item
Solution Approach 1:
The system performs preliminary automated ranking of resumes against job postings using standardized profile comparison before human reviewers examine the results. This preliminary action filters and prioritizes candidates based on objective criteria, so that when humans do review resumes, they focus only on the most promising matches rather than examining every single one individually
Solution Approach 2:
The standardized profile acts as an intermediary between the raw resume data and the matching process. By introducing this intermediate representation with standardized attributes and metrics, the system enables automated algorithms to perform initial filtering and ranking, bridging the gap between unstructured data and human decision-making
3Speed
If automated systems are implemented for comparing data sets, then processing speed increases, but the ability to handle non-standardized data formats becomes more difficult
Solution Approach 1:
The patent segments the resume and job posting data into distinct standardized components or attributes (such as skills, experience, education, requirements, qualifications). By dividing the unstructured data into standardized segments with defined formats, the system can process each segment independently using automated algorithms, thereby increasing processing speed while managing complexity through modular design

AI summary
A computer-based system and method is described for converting non-standardized resumes and job listings into standardized profiles that can be easily searched, compared and referenced. Attributes are identified within the resumes and job listings, and are evaluated for various features. Each resume or job listing is broken down into its component parts and analyzed based on a logic-based routine to identify and package meaningful content.
